Silent Witnesses exhibition opens in Yerevan

PanARMENIAN.Net - Silent Witnesses exhibition opened in Yerevan on November 29 as part of 16 Days of Activism Against Gender Violence Campaign.

The aim of the event is to raise public awareness about violence in families.

The exhibition features 9 women’s silhouettes on which the stories of women who suffered from family violence are written.
